leave the ends to callus over, then place it in a container with some rocks or spaghnum moss or a bit of soil, add some water but not to much, place the stem in there in a way that it doesnt really get wet, close the container with a lid or cling film and make sure its pretty much airtight. place in a bright warm spot direct sun is maybe a bit to much but if you have a non clear see through container it can be done, wait a few days if there is no condensation then add a little bit of water. check once every few days to make sure there isnt any fungus growing. should develop roots in a few weeks.
